He’s a Mets legend … Jay Horwitz is one of the most good-hearted and inspiring officials at the New York Mets. As the Mets’ long-time PR director, Horwitz shaped some of the most memorable moments in team history. He discusses his childhood, career and message to kids with disabilities with host Charles Mizrahi.

Guest Bio:

Jay Horwitz is an author, podcast host and media relations official for the New York Mets. As the former head of PR, Horwitz became a trusted friend and mentor to generations of players.

Today, he continues to support these players as the alumni director. Horwitz also hosts a biweekly podcast (below) in which he sits down with former Mets players, coaches and other officials to discuss all things baseball. In addition, he released his incredible memoir last year. It chronicles his childhood struggles, passion for sports and long-term career for the Mets.
